Ticket #3302: Billing worker connection failures after blue-green cutover

For weekly sync. Post-cutover, the Tallowpay billing worker's green fleet couldn't reach the ledger DB — pool exhausted within 40s. Cause: blue fleet never released connections during drain. Mitigation: forced blue shutdown, raised pool cap. Action items: add drain hook, alert on pool saturation. Green fleet currently connects with the string below.

primary connection of yagep-kahip = redis://giliel_svc:zYiKsLL2PLpfPL@db-348f.xolmarsys.corp:5432/fenwyn

## Configuration — FeedCheck Validator

FeedCheck validates podcast RSS feeds before Hollowcast ingestion. Copy env.sample to .env, then set FEEDCHECK_STRICT=true for production and FEEDCHECK_MAX_ITEMS to match the customer's tier. Support staff should never edit validation rules directly; only environment values. Results are pushed to the Hollowcast reporting API, which authenticates with a token defined on the following line.

vault entry, yahif-yajep: COURIER_KEY29=b802bdf8034096b65a51c6ba5abe2

## Who to contact: Marlin Points Ledger

Reviewers of changes to the Marlin loyalty-points ledger should note that balance-affecting code paths require two approvals, one from the ledger core team. Schema changes also need sign-off from data governance at Tollery Group. For routine review questions, ping the ledger channel; for anything touching accrual math, contact the ledger maintainers at the address below.

escalation mailbox, yajeg-bageg: quenax.olidor@lumiccorp.internal